E-Commerce and Its Real-Time Requirements: Modeling E-Commerce as a Real-Time Systemer will discuss the technical requirements of e-commerce, such as interoperability, reliability, accessibility, timeliness, and security. In particular, the presentation will show how e-commerce can often be modeled by a real-time system and hence solutions to these requirements can be more readily formulated.

Measures to Get Better Quality Databases this work, we will propose a set of metrics for measuring the complexity of the well known Entity Relationship schemas, which will allow database designers to measure the complexity of conceptual designs in order to improve their quality. We will also put them under theoretical validation following Zusc’s formal framework.
